Most folks I found with the same problem were solved with the first two steps:
1. Click Start, click Run, and then type CMD. 
2. At the prompt, type REGSVR32 APPWIZ.CPL. 

If you must go through step 5, be sure to read everything before beginning. I *think* 
that "upgrade" refers to "repair" on the xp cd. I would "try to fix this issue without 
upgrading" (just below 5-c) first.
